摘要
With the hope of obtaining information about the canted spin structure which has been proposed by Nakagawa et al. on the basis of their neutron diffraction study, the Mn55 NMR frequency has been measured as a function of external magnetic field. A value of (—1.03±0.03) MHz/kOe has been obtained for dν/dH at 77°K. This value seems to suggest that β1MnZn has a simple ferromagnetic spin structure, if it is not the case that the hyperfine field at the Mn55 nucleus lies accidentally along the ferromagnetic component due to the effects of the neighboring Mn moments. The results of the observation of the Zn67 NMR is appended. The hyperfine field at the Zn67 nucleus is —270. kOe at 4.2°K. © 1969, THE PHYSICAL SOCIETY OF JAPAN. All rights reserved.
